Why You Should Renovate Your Windows

Windows are an essential element of any home. They offer symmetry and style, as they perform vital functions. If your home has outdated double-glazed windows, renovating them can reduce heating bills and help reduce environmental pollution.

The two panes are separated by an gas or air layer which acts as a heat-insulator. It also helps prevent condensation, which can cause frames to rot and cause discoloration to furniture.

Energy efficiency

Double glazing can enhance the energy efficiency in your home. It prevents heat from escaping out of windows and doors. You will save money on your energy bill and will also be helping the environment. It also helps reduce noise pollution within your home, making it easier to rest and sleep.

Durability

Double-glazed windows are made of durable materials that last for a long time. They are also easy to maintain and resistant to moisture. They're also less susceptible to UV rays and simple to modify, so you can pick the colours and designs that are a perfect match for your home. They're also energy efficient, which means they can reduce your electric costs by regulating the temperature of your home.

They also aid in limiting condensation since the airtight seal keeps moisture from condensing on the glass. These benefits can result in significant savings on energy costs. Additionally, they can improve the sound insulation and help to prevent drafts from entering your house.

Upvc is a strong material with a lifespan of 30 years or more. They're also a more eco-friendly option than wooden windows, and they can be recycled when they are worn out. It is essential to buy a top-quality product, because uPVC which is inexpensive can fade and stain over time.

Double glazing is more energy efficient than single-glazed windows because the insulating air creates an airtight seal between the two panes. This will help you save money on your heating bills and reduce carbon emissions.
